Set 19 years after The Deathly Hallows , the script follows Harry Potter, now an overworked employee of the Ministry of Magic, and his youngest son, Albus Severus Potter, who struggles with the heavy burden of his family legacy. Harry-Potter-and-the-Cursed-Child English

Harry Potter and the Cursed Child (English Edition) is a pivotal, albeit controversial, addition to the wizarding world that acts as the eighth story in the series. Unlike the novels, this is published as a rehearsal script for the stage production.

The play focuses heavily on parenthood, friendship, time, and breaking the cycle of generational trauma.
